By Product Type
Gas Combi Boiler:
Gas combi boilers are the most popular type in the market, primarily due to their efficiency and cost-effectiveness. Utilizing natural gas as fuel, these boilers provide rapid heating and hot water supply, making them ideal for households with high hot water demands. The installation of gas combi boilers is relatively straightforward, which contributes to their widespread adoption. Moreover, advancements in technology have improved their efficiency ratings, resulting in lower energy bills for users. As governments emphasize cleaner energy solutions, gas combi boilers are being designed to have lower emissions, appealing to environmentally conscious consumers. The growing focus on energy efficiency in residential heating solutions further cements the position of gas combi boilers in the market.
Oil Combi Boiler:
Oil combi boilers, while not as widely adopted as their gas counterparts, serve a specific market segment, particularly in areas where natural gas is not available. These boilers use heating oil to provide hot water and central heating, offering a viable solution for residential and commercial applications. One significant advantage of oil combi boilers is their ability to generate higher outputs, making them suitable for larger properties. However, the fluctuating prices of oil can impact their operational costs, which can be a drawback for some users. Nonetheless, advancements in oil combustion technology are leading to more efficient and cleaner operations, making oil combi boilers a relevant choice in certain markets.
Electric Combi Boiler:
Electric combi boilers are increasingly gaining traction, particularly in regions where electricity costs are competitive. These units offer the convenience of hot water and heating without the need for gas or oil, which can be particularly beneficial in urban areas with limited infrastructure. Electric combi boilers are compact and easy to install, requiring less maintenance compared to traditional fuel-based boilers. They present an environmentally friendly option, especially when sourced from renewable energy. However, their operational costs may vary depending on local electricity prices, which can affect their attractiveness. Nevertheless, the push towards electrification in heating systems and the integration of renewable technologies are expected to drive the growth of electric combi boilers.
Dual Fuel Combi Boiler:
Dual fuel combi boilers provide flexibility and convenience, utilizing both gas and oil or alternate fuels, depending on availability and cost. This versatility allows users to switch between fuel sources, optimizing energy consumption and potentially reducing costs. These systems are particularly advantageous in regions where energy prices fluctuate or where access to one fuel type may be limited. The dual-fuel option can enhance the performance of heating systems, offering consumers a reliable solution for all their heating needs. As energy management becomes increasingly important, dual fuel combi boilers represent a strategic choice for users looking for adaptable and efficient heating options.
Biomass Combi Boiler:
Biomass combi boilers are gaining popularity due to the rising trend towards renewable energy sources and sustainability. These systems utilize organic materials, such as wood pellets or chips, to generate heat and hot water, appealing to environmentally conscious consumers. Biomass combi boilers can significantly reduce carbon footprints, and their installation is often incentivized by government policies promoting green energy. Although the initial investment may be higher compared to traditional systems, the long-term savings on fuel costs and the environmental benefits contribute to their growing market share. Moreover, the increasing availability of biomass fuels and technological advancements in combustion efficiency are further driving the adoption of biomass combi boilers.
By Application
Residential:
The residential segment constitutes a significant portion of the combi boiler market, driven by the growing demand for efficient heating solutions among homeowners. With the increasing focus on energy efficiency and reducing carbon footprints, consumers are more inclined towards systems that can provide both heating and hot water without occupying excessive space. Combi boilers are particularly appealing as they eliminate the need for bulky water tanks while offering quick and efficient service. The trend towards modern and smart homes has further accelerated the adoption of combi boilers, as they can be easily integrated into smart home systems. Additionally, many residential developments are now designed with energy efficiency in mind, making combi boilers an essential component of new housing projects.
Commercial:
In the commercial sector, combi boilers are increasingly being utilized for their adaptability and efficiency. Businesses are seeking solutions that can cater to high-volume hot water demands while minimizing energy costs. Combi boilers are well-suited for various commercial applications, including hotels, restaurants, and retail spaces, where a constant supply of hot water is crucial. The ability to combine space heating and hot water production into a single unit makes combi boilers an attractive option for commercial enterprises. Furthermore, as businesses strive to meet sustainability goals, the energy-efficient qualities of combi boilers align with these objectives, further driving their adoption in the commercial sector. Additionally, government regulations favoring energy-efficient systems in commercial buildings contribute to the growth of this segment.

By Fuel Type
Natural Gas:
Natural gas is the most widely utilized fuel type in the combi boiler market, primarily due to its availability, affordability, and efficiency. Gas combi boilers provide rapid heating and hot water, making them suitable for various residential and commercial applications. The infrastructure for natural gas distribution is well established in many regions, facilitating easy installation and access for consumers. Furthermore, advancements in technology have led to improved efficiency ratings, which translate to reduced energy costs for users. The government’s push for cleaner energy solutions also supports the growth of natural gas combi boilers, as they typically produce lower emissions compared to oil-based systems.
LPG:
Liquefied Petroleum Gas (LPG) is another fuel type commonly used in combi boilers, especially in areas where natural gas infrastructure is lacking. LPG is a versatile and efficient fuel that allows for quick heating and hot water production. These systems are particularly advantageous in rural and semi-urban areas, where access to natural gas may be limited. LPG combi boilers are designed to provide a similar performance level as natural gas models, making them an attractive alternative for consumers. Additionally, the growing adoption of LPG in residential and commercial applications is driven by its lower carbon emissions compared to traditional oil systems, aligning with sustainability goals.
Oil:
Oil continues to be a relevant fuel type in the combi boiler market, particularly in regions where natural gas and LPG are not readily available. Oil combi boilers offer a reliable solution for heating and hot water needs, often delivering higher outputs suitable for larger properties. However, the fluctuating prices of oil can impact operational costs, which may deter some consumers. Despite these challenges, advancements in oil combustion technology have led to improved efficiency and reduced emissions, making oil combi boilers a viable option for specific market segments. Government incentives aimed at promoting energy-efficient heating solutions further encourage the installation of oil-based systems in certain areas.
Electric:
Electric combi boilers represent a growing segment in the market, catering to consumers looking for an alternative to traditional fuel sources. These systems are particularly suited for urban areas where space is limited and gas lines may not reach. Electric combi boilers have the advantage of being compact, requiring minimal maintenance and offering a higher level of safety compared to gas or oil systems. As the energy landscape shifts towards electrification, driven by the increased adoption of renewable energy sources, electric combi boilers are becoming more appealing. However, their operational costs can vary based on local electricity rates, which consumers must consider when evaluating their options.
